WebJun 12, 2024 · While configuring a custom action or Running a diagnostics (lets say collect a memory dump) on Memory limit, it is strongly advised to use the CollectKillAnalyze switch so that the process taking memory is killed after the custom action executions because this will prevent multiple custom actions to be invoked for the same process. Every web app will eventually encounter some … WebJul 14, 2024 · One of the most powerful (yet least used) diagnostic features of Azure App Service is the Failed Request Tracing feature. All apps hosted on App Services using the Windows stack can benefit from this feature. Failed Request Tracing is a powerful feature of IIS and Azure App Service gets it for free.
